In addition to the establishment of communication towers by operators, the mobile phone communication problem can be solved by installing mobile phone signal amplifiers, wireless repeaters and digital fiber repeaters if there is no mobile phone signal. First of all, a base station is a public mobile communication base station, also known as a public network, which is an interface device for mobile devices to access the Internet, and is also a form of radio station. Cell phone signal amplifiers and repeaters, digital fiber repeaters are composed of antennas, RF duplexers, low noise amplifiers, mixers, ESC attenuators, combiners, filters, power amplifiers and other components or modules. composition, including uplink and downlink amplification links, fiber jumpers, etc.

The working principle of a base station is a radio transceiver station that transmits information with a mobile phone terminal through a mobile communication switching center in a certain radio coverage area. Mobile phone signal amplifiers, wireless repeaters and digital fiber repeaters use the receiving antenna (donor antenna) to receive the downlink signal of the base station into the repeater amplifier, and amplify the useful signal through the low-noise amplifier to suppress the noise signal in the signal. Improve the signal-to-noise ratio (S/N); then down-converted to the intermediate frequency signal, filtered by a filter, amplified at the intermediate frequency, and then frequency-shifted and up-converted to the radio frequency, amplified by the power amplifier, and transmitted by the transmitting antenna (retransmission antenna). Mobile stations, mobile terminals, etc., to ensure communication requirements, achieve the purpose of signal blind area coverage, and thus solve the signal requirements.
